    Today’s DCU news is that Superman now releases two days early internationally, plus some potato quality Supergirl set images to ponder. Let’s start with some official DCU news. It has been announced by WB that Superman will now release two days early outside of the US. So that’s a July 9th premiere date for what seems to be everyone except domestic audiences. We’ve gotten used to global releases with Marvel, but this approach is still very common.
